The Role of Distilled Water in Maintaining Good Health

February 20, 2023 By DistilledWaterAssociation

Distilled water is a popular choice for those who are looking for a pure and clean source of hydration. It is created through a process of boiling and condensation, which removes impurities and contaminants from the water. This type of water can play an important role in maintaining good health. Here are some of the ways that distilled water can support your health.

Reduces exposure to contaminants: Distilled water is free of contaminants that can be found in tap water. This includes bacteria, viruses, and chemicals that can be harmful to your health. By drinking distilled water, you can reduce your exposure to these contaminants and protect your body from harm.

Supports the body’s natural detoxification processes: Drinking distilled water can help support the body’s natural detoxification processes. As the water is free of impurities, it can help flush out toxins from the body, leading to better overall health.

Helps maintain proper hydration levels: Distilled water is pure and clean, which makes it easier for the body to absorb and utilize. This makes it an effective way to maintain proper hydration levels, which is important for the health of all bodily systems.

Promotes better digestion: The purity of distilled water may help improve digestion. Drinking water before and after meals can help stimulate the production of digestive enzymes and improve the movement of food through the digestive system.

Can be used for cooking and cleaning: In addition to being used for drinking, distilled water can also be used for cooking and cleaning. Its purity makes it ideal for use in recipes and for cleaning surfaces that come into contact with food.

Overall, distilled water is a pure and clean source of hydration that can play an important role in maintaining good health. By reducing exposure to contaminants, supporting the body’s natural detoxification processes, maintaining hydration levels, and improving digestion, distilled water can help keep your body functioning at its best.

It’s important to note that while distilled water is generally considered safe for drinking, it may not be appropriate for everyone. Certain minerals that are found in other types of water may be missing from distilled water, which can lead to potential health issues over time. It’s important to talk to your doctor to determine whether distilled water is a good choice for you.
